Develops integrated systems for vehicles
Aptiv develops integrated vehicle systems for the automotive industry, focusing on software-defined vehicles. Their products help tackle challenges related to autonomous driving, vehicle electrification, and advanced safety features. Aptiv collaborates with major car manufacturers and other mobility stakeholders to enhance vehicle performance and safety through their technological solutions. Unlike many competitors, Aptiv emphasizes a partnership model, providing ongoing support and integration of their systems into vehicles. The company's goal is to improve the overall driving experience and safety in vehicles while advancing the future of mobility.
